What Is Artificial Intelligence? 
Artificial Intelligence refers to the development of computer systems capable of performing tasks that typically require human intelligence. These include learning, reasoning, problem-solving, perception, and natural language understanding. AI technologies can be broadly categorized into: 
Narrow AI: Focused on specific tasks, such as virtual assistants (e.g., Siri, Alexa) or recommendation systems. 
General AI: A theoretical form of AI that possesses human-like cognitive abilities across a wide range of tasks. 

Key AI Technologies 
1. Machine Learning (ML): A subset of AI that enables computers to learn from data and improve over time without explicit programming. 
2. Natural Language Processing (NLP): Powers applications like chatbots and language translation by enabling machines to understand and respond to human language. 
3. Computer Vision: Allows systems to interpret visual data, crucial for facial recognition and autonomous vehicles. 
4. Robotics: Combines AI with mechanical engineering to create machines capable of performing physical tasks. 

Applications of AI 
AI is transforming industries by streamlining processes, enhancing decision-making, and unlocking new possibilities: 

Healthcare: AI-powered tools assist in diagnosing diseases, predicting patient outcomes, and personalizing treatment plans. 
Finance: AI algorithms analyze market trends, detect fraud, and automate trading. 
Retail: Recommendation systems enhance customer experiences by personalizing shopping journeys. 
Transportation: Autonomous vehicles and smart traffic management systems are making travel safer and more efficient. 
Education: AI-driven platforms enable personalized learning experiences for students of all ages. 

Challenges and Ethical Considerations 
While AI presents immense opportunities, it also raises critical questions about ethics, bias, and privacy: 
Bias in AI: Ensuring algorithms are trained on diverse datasets to prevent discrimination. 
Job Displacement: Balancing automation with the need for human employment. 
Data Privacy: Safeguarding sensitive information in AI-driven systems.
